#faaf7d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#faaf7d is composed of 98% red, 68.6% green and 49%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 30% magenta, 50%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 24 degrees, a saturation of 92.6% and a lightness of 73.5%. #faaf7d color hex could be obtained by blending #fffffa with #f55f00. Closest websafe color is: #ff9966.

Shades and Tints of #faaf7d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020100 is the darkest color, while #fef5ee is the lightest one.

Tones of #faaf7d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#bcbbbb is the less saturated color, while #faaf7d is the most saturated one.
